Description
Problem
DBM correlation was broken for PDO prepared statements. The traceparent SQL comment which DBM uses to correlate database queries with APM traces contained a span_id that didn't match the span representing the actual query execution.
Root Cause
When using prepared statements (PDO::prepare() + PDOStatement::execute()):
This prevented DBM from properly correlating database queries with their corresponding APM spans.
Solution
Following the RFC we now use SERVICE mode (DBM_PROPAGATION_SERVICE) for prepared statements instead of FULL mode.
